Growth-hormone secretagogue with an approved medical use. Discussed around belly fat and GH support.
Tesamorelin is a growth-hormone secretagogue generally discussed in relation to belly fat and growth-hormone support. It has an approved medical use, which sets it apart from some other peptides in its family.
TRKD+ lists it at a Growing tier. It is sometimes paired with ipamorelin or CJC-1295 in blends people discuss.

Vocabulary
Terms you’ll see with it.
- Protocol
Peptide
A short chain of amino acids. Smaller than a protein, larger than a single amino acid.
- Route
Subcutaneous
Injected into the fat layer just under the skin. Short needle, shallow angle.
- Prep
Reconstitution
Mixing a dry powder peptide with sterile water so it can be drawn into a syringe.
- Timing
Half-life
How long it takes for half of a dose to clear your system. Drives dosing frequency.
